You perform a co-transduction experiment with pro+ gal+ arg- man- donor and pro- gal- arg+ man+ recipient. On master plate 1, you select for 1000 pro+ transductants. By screening, you find 400 colonies are gal+, 290 are arg+, and 1000 are man+. On master plate 2, you select for 1000 gal+ transductants. By screening, you find 390 colonies are pro+, 289 are arg+, and 900 are man+. Circle ALL of the following orders which may be possible given the above results. (All or nothing) a. gal---arg---man---pro b. arg---pro---gal---man c. arg--- man---pro---gal d. pro---arg---gal--- man e. pro---gal---man---arg f. pro---gal---arg---man g. None of the above'
